Abstract

A method for optimizing resource allocation for signal conditioning of DSL or other signal lines includes developing a signal quality metric using crosstalk interference and, optionally, signal to noise level. Use of existing pilot tone training selectively assigned to signal lines allows determination of the signal quality metric. A threshold level is selected and all signal lines having a signal quality metric above the threshold level are assigned crosstalk cancellation resources. Because the total number of signal lines requiring crosstalk cancellation is not known at the beginning, a particular threshold level may result in allocation of more than the available resources or allocation of significantly less than the available resources. When this happens the threshold level may be adjusted and the process repeated until crosstalk cancellation resources are assigned up to a usable limit.
